What does a business development program manager do?

A Business Development Program Manager oversees initiatives to grow a company's business by identifying new markets, forming strategic partnerships, and driving revenue opportunities. They coordinate cross-functional teams, manage program timelines, and ensure alignment with organizational goals. Their role often involves analyzing market trends, developing proposals, and negotiating contracts to maximize business growth. They also track progress and report results to stakeholders to ensure program success.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a business development program manager?

To thrive as a Business Development Program Manager, you need strong skills in strategic planning, market analysis, relationship management, and a relevant degree such as in business, marketing, or a related field. Proficiency with CRM platforms (like Salesforce), project management tools (such as Asana or Trello), and data analysis software is typically required. Excellent communication, negotiation, and leadership abilities help you build partnerships and drive cross-functional initiatives. These competencies are crucial for identifying growth opportunities, managing complex projects, and ensuring successful business expansion.

How does a business development program manager typically collaborate with sales and product teams to drive growth?

A Business Development Program Manager often acts as a bridge between sales and product teams, aligning go-to-market strategies with product capabilities. They facilitate regular meetings to gather market feedback from sales representatives and relay it to product managers, ensuring offerings meet client needs. Additionally, they may coordinate joint initiatives such as pilot programs or customer workshops, tracking progress and adjusting plans based on performance metrics. This cross-functional collaboration is essential for identifying new opportunities, refining solutions, and achieving revenue targets.

Job description

Job Description

The Business Development Manager will play a key role in driving revenue growth and strengthening the firm’s market position across priority clients and sectors in the US. This role combines strategic planning, data-driven decision-making and hands-on execution to deliver measurable business outcomes. 

Working closely with partners, client team leads, and colleagues across Business Development, Marketing and Commercial functions, the Business Development Manager will develop and implement targeted initiatives aligned with firmwide priorities, with a strong focus on ROI, performance tracking and continuous optimization. 

Key Responsibilities 

Strategic Business Development 

  • Partner with US-based partners, client team leads and regional leadership to develop and execute business development plans aligned with strategic priorities, with clear success metrics and ROI tracking  

  • Collaborate with Marketing and Commercial colleagues to ensure alignment between market positioning, campaigns and revenue objectives  

  • Identify and prioritize new client opportunities, markets and revenue streams using data, market intelligence and client insights  

Revenue Growth and ROI Measurement 

  • Establish KPIs for BD and marketing initiatives, tracking performance against revenue, pipeline growth and client engagement metrics  

  • Work with Commercial and Finance colleagues to evaluate return on investment and inform budget allocation and prioritization  

  • Provide regular, insight-led reporting to stakeholders, clearly linking activity to commercial outcomes  

Client Development and Cross-Selling 

  • Facilitate cross-selling initiatives by working with partners, client teams and BD colleagues to identify opportunities across regions and services  

  • Support and help coordinate client teams for key accounts, ensuring integrated execution across BD, Marketing and Commercial functions  

  • Leverage CRM data and client insights to strengthen relationships and identify expansion opportunities  

Pursuits, Pitches and Competitive Intelligence 

  • Collaborate closely with BD and RFP teams to develop winning pursuit strategies, including positioning, messaging and team selection  

  • Work with Marketing colleagues to ensure consistent, differentiated messaging and high-quality supporting materials  

  • Develop and share competitive intelligence and market insights to inform strategy across BD, Marketing and Commercial teams  

Data, Technology and AI Enablement 

  • Utilize CRM and data platforms to track leads, manage pipeline visibility and generate actionable insights  

  • Partner with BD, Marketing and Commercial colleagues to improve data quality, reporting and insight generation  

  • Champion the use of data analytics and emerging technologies, including AI tools, to enhance targeting, personalization and BD effectiveness  

Profile Raising and Market Engagement 

  • Work with Marketing and Communications teams to raise the profile of partners and the firm through thought leadership, campaigns and digital channels  

  • Collaborate with Events teams and BD colleagues to design and deliver strategic client programs, with clear objectives and post-event ROI evaluation  

  • Ensure content and messaging are aligned across BD, Marketing and Commercial priorities  

Collaboration and Capability Building 

  • Act as a connector across BD, Marketing and Commercial teams, ensuring a coordinated and consistent approach to client development  

  • Support capability-building initiatives across the US business, including BD training and best practice sharing  

  • Contribute to a culture of accountability, innovation and continuous improvement
